Sewer Line Unblocking in San Antonio, TX
Sewer line unblocking services are designed to clear blockages and restore proper flow in underground sewer pipes. These services typically address issues such as slow drains, foul odors, or backups in sinks, toilets, and other plumbing fixtures. Projects can range from removing debris, grease buildup, or tree roots that have infiltrated the sewer line, to resolving more complex obstructions that disrupt household wastewater systems. Property owners often want to understand the causes of blockages, the methods used to clear them, and any potential need for further repairs to prevent future problems.
Before requesting sewer line unblocking services, homeowners should consider the location of the blockage, the age and condition of the sewer system, and whether there have been recurring issues. It’s helpful to know if the property has a history of plumbing problems or tree roots nearby, as these factors can influence the approach taken. Understanding the scope of the project and any necessary follow-up work can ensure the process is straightforward and effective in maintaining a properly functioning sewer system.

Signs Of Sewer Blockages
Slow drains, gurgling sounds, and foul odors may indicate a sewer line clog in your san antonio home.
Common Causes Of Unblocking Issues
Tree roots, debris buildup, and grease accumulation are typical reasons for sewer line obstructions in residential properties.
Preventive Maintenance Tips
Regular inspections and avoiding flushing non-degradable items can help maintain clear sewer lines in san antonio residences.

Sewer Line Unblocking Questions
What causes a sewer line to become blocked? Blockages can result from tree roots, accumulated debris, grease buildup, or damaged pipes obstructing flow.
How can I tell if my sewer line is blocked? Signs include multiple drains backing up, foul odors, gurgling sounds, or water pooling around drains.
What methods are used to unblock a sewer line? Techniques include hydro jetting, snaking, and inspection with cameras to locate and clear obstructions.
